RedPath Radio

Marika Sila

RedPath Radio, hosted by actress Marika Sila, is a health, wellness, culture and career building podcast highlighting Indigenous community leaders and interviewing the top athletes, artists and entrepreneurs in the world. The goal is to bridge the gap of understanding between all races by exchanging knowledge so we can grow and thrive together.
